• Home
  • Line#
  • Scopes#
  • Navigate#
  • Raw
  • Download
1# checkdeps.py shouldn't check include paths for files in these dirs:
2skip_child_includes = [
3  "build",
4]
5
6# Do NOT add chrome to the list below.  We shouldn't be including files from
7# src/chrome in src/webkit.
8include_rules = [
9  # For bridge/c/c_utility.h in npruntime_util.cc
10  "+bridge",
11  "+cc",
12  "-cc/surfaces",
13  "+grit",  # For generated headers
14  "+skia",
15  "+third_party/angle",
16  "+third_party/hyphen",
17  "+third_party/leveldatabase",
18  "+third_party/skia",
19  "+third_party/sqlite",
20  "+third_party/tcmalloc",
21  "+third_party/WebKit/public/platform",
22  "+third_party/WebKit/public/web",
23  "+v8",
24
25  # For databases/
26  "+sql",
27  "+storage",
28
29  # For gpu/
30  "+ui/gfx",
31  "+ui/gl",
32  "+gpu/GLES2",
33  "+gpu/command_buffer/client",
34  "+gpu/command_buffer/common",
35  "+gpu/command_buffer/service",
36  "+gpu/skia_bindings",
37  "+third_party/khronos/GLES2",
38
39  # TODO(brettw) - review these; move up if it's ok, or remove the dependency
40  "+net",
41  "+third_party/npapi/bindings",
42
43  # webkit/support is only test support code, nothing outside of webkit/support
44  # should pull it in.
45  "-webkit/support",
46]
47